Sans Superellipse Vogi 8 is a light, very wide, monoline, upright, normal x-height font.

A geometric sans built from rounded-rectangle and superelliptical forms, with consistent stroke weight and a smooth, engineered curve-to-straight rhythm. Terminals are clean and softened rather than sharply cut, and many joins resolve into gentle corners that keep the texture even. Counters tend to be open and horizontally oriented, with several letters showing purposeful breaks or inset strokes that create a modular, constructed feel. Overall spacing and proportions favor a broad footprint and a calm, even color in text, while distinctive constructions (notably in diagonals and some bowls) add a technical character.
Well-suited to contemporary branding, tech-forward headlines, product naming, and interface typography where a clean geometric voice is desired. The wide stance and distinctive modular details make it especially effective for titles, signage, and short blocks of text where character shapes can be appreciated.
The font reads as futuristic and system-like, projecting a sleek, high-tech tone with a controlled, minimal personality. Its rounded geometry keeps it friendly enough for interface contexts, but the deliberate cuts and segmented details push it toward sci‑fi, digital, and industrial cues.
The design appears intended to merge the cleanliness of a modern sans with a superelliptical, constructed geometry that feels optimized for digital environments. By combining soft corners with occasional segmented strokes, it aims to be both approachable and distinctly technical.
Diagonal letters adopt crisp, angular geometry that contrasts with the superelliptical bowls, giving the design a recognizable signature. Numerals echo the same rounded-rect structure, emphasizing horizontal motion and a streamlined, display-ready presence.
